(HealthNewsDigest.com) – Rhinoplasty or the “nose job” as it is more commonly known is a cosmetic surgical procedure that can be used to reshape and alter the nose. However, rhinoplasty is capable of more than simply correcting a person’s looks, it can be helpful in improving more serious problems such as speech errors and breathing difficulties that arise due to a nasal block. This form of surgery is fantastic when it comes to altering the shape and size of your nosRe, while keeping the overall look of the face natural and proportionate.

Types of Rhinoplasty
Successful rhinoplasty procedures require care and planning. Each aspect of the nose needs to be carefully considered in regards to one another so that the surgeon can assess the overall impact of whatever he does. Rhinoplasty is generally performed in one of two distinct ways. Generally, the most preferred approach is the closed option, in which no external incisions to the outside of the nose are made. The advantage of this approach is that because incisions are made internally, all scars are effectively hidden.
In the open approach to rhinoplasty, a small incision will be made along the Columella of the nose. This incision is also designed with as much care as possible, to ensure that as the nose begins to heal, any scars are inconspicuous and difficult to notice. Generally, when someone is viewed at eye level, it will not be possible to see the scar on the nose.
